Balance and Static Equilibrium (PhET Activity) (1) ~ Search Layout References View Help Design Mailings Review 5. Turn the picture above into an extended free-body diagram. In the picture above, draw in the forces pushing downward on the beam due to the weight of each collection of bricks from each mass. Label the forces with the symbols wy, w2, and w3. (Note that there is a checkbox in the program for "Forces from Objects" that can help you with this step.) Next, draw the weight of the beam at its "center of mass" which should be at its center if the beam is uniform. Consider the beam to have a mass of 10 kg to help you draw the size of the arrow. Label the force with the symbol when. Lastly, draw the upward normal force exerted on the beam by the hinge at the pivot point that serves to counterbalance all of the downward weight forces. Label the force with the symbol n. 6. Calculate Torques: Fill in the table below. . Start by listing the downward force exerted on the beam due to the weight of each object (treat g-10 m/s ). Next, record the "lever arm" (distance from pivot) for each object. . Next, calculate the magnitude of the torque exerted by each object about the pivot by noting that it is equal to the product of force and lever arm. Lastly, include the appropriate sign for each torque in the table by noting that torques which attempt to rotate bodies counterclockwise are usually treated as positive, while those that try to rotate the system clockwise are treated as negative.
